I think there could be a case for Miller being overrated. His shooting was as good as advertised, but as an entire player, I'm not sure he was as well-rounded as many of his contemporaries for which he is often mentioned amongst. He was great, but I admit it's been interesting to watch his legend grow a bit as time passes.
All that said, I think that legend exists in large part due to his finest moments. He wasn't much of a lock-down defender and at 6'7'', you couldn't even count on him for four rebounds a night, but when he did what he did best, it was oftentimes memorable (frequently against New York).
Also, in terms of 2K fans, I think he and Charles Barkley get extra attention simply because they're two of the only stars remaining from recent history who haven't been included in 2K yet (unless we count Barkley's Dream Team appearance in 2K13). If Miller had been in since 2K12 and David Robinson were missing, I think we'd all just be clamoring for the Admiral instead.
No doubt its a debatable discussion, but who has over hyped him? He is a player that averaged 18 points a game and is arguably one of the best 3pt shooters and clutch shooters of all time, With that said I would not put him in a top 5 greatest SG of all time list, but when you think Pacers basketball the name Reggie Miller comes to mind almost automatically even to this day, cant disregard that.

He's not even a top 50 player of All-Time, he and Mitch Richmond made the HoF too quickly IMO, great shooter but pretty one dimensional. He has a reputation as a clutch player because of famous exploits but people act like he didn't have some of his worst games in elimination games and he had one of the worst games of his career in the 2000 Finals.
I rather have more elite/championship 2000's teams, a Pistons team with prime Grant Hill, '99 Knicks, '99 Heat. Among other teams than Reggie Miller.Comment
